Abstract

The utility model relates to a land oil drilling rig capable of integrally moving, which comprises a bottom sledge positioned on the bottom of the drilling rig, the bottom sledge is composed of two main sledges and four auxiliary sledges, wherein the auxiliary sledges are positioned on both ends of the main sledges, and eight connecting pinholes are respectively arranged on the inner sides of the auxiliary sledges of the drilling rig, and a connecting support of a mobile device is fixed through a pin shaft by the connecting pinholes. The drilling rig of the utility model is characterized in that a moveable device A is arranged on the bottom of the drilling rig and is connected with the auxiliary sledges of the drilling rig through the pin shaft, and the auxiliary sledges are one part of the bottom sledge of the drilling rig and also can be an independent mechanism for the integral moving of the drilling rig, and the movable device is a device which has simple structure and convenient assembly, and can realize the transverse moving of the drilling rig, and can be together used by a plurality of similar drilling rigs in the same area.

Background technology
The integral body of petroleum gas rig moves, and is used for beating in same well site the occasion that cluster well or short distance are moved.In this case, in very short distance, remove drilling machinery, also can cause the prolongation of duration simultaneously then reinstalling meeting waste lot of manpower and material resources.The whole shift position that study rig this moment has very high practical value, also is the emphasis of exploitation in the present oil and gas exploration field.
Many for the method and apparatus research that the integral body of electric drilling machine moves, wherein commonly used is guide tracked moving and the step type hydraulic translation.Guide tracked move of drilling machinery is earlier the rig substructure that is moved to be risen to certain altitude, then guide rail pulled into the rig substructure below, moves rig substructure being placed on the guide rail.This method mainly is that lifting rig substructure labour intensity is big, and guide rail is laid road pavement and required high.
Another kind is the step type hydraulic translation, and the step type hydraulic translating device that wherein relates to has " the whole mobile device of multi roll rig " of applying for utility model patent, and the patent No. is 200620078512.0.Mention the whole mobile device of a kind of multi roll rig in this patent, this device comprises jacking cylinder, translation oil cylinder, rotary oil cylinder and base, the running roller lower shoe is installed on the base, frame is set around the running roller lower shoe, row has running roller in the frame, the running roller upper end is provided with the top roll wheel carrier, is fixed with jacking cylinder on it, and the piston otic placode of jacking cylinder and crossbeam connect; The jacking cylinder both sides are provided with translation oil cylinder, and translation oil cylinder one end is provided with moving earrings and base connects, and the other end is provided with motionless earrings and the top roll wheel carrier connects; Above-mentioned rotary oil cylinder one end is fixed on the top roll wheel carrier, and the other end is connected with rig substructure.
When above-mentioned step type hydraulic mobile device is connected on the rig substructure, be to be connected with the rig substructure two ends with otic placode, pin by connecting carriage, span is bigger, and the weight of rig mainly concentrates on the bottom girder stage casing of end sled, bottom girder distortion when preventing that rig from moving, therefore improve rigidity, requirement of strength, and the measure of being taked is for increasing the sectional dimension of bottom girder to bottom girder.The increase that bottom girder is increased, the thickening measure can bring bottom girder weight again except increasing manufacturing cost and time cost, is also moved for rig is whole and is made troubles.
